Output d327937f0a8a04bf914da3c11cb2a3b4896cff788421609c1d3bf47eaa1f45ae:0

value
6947838932586
script pubkey
OP_0 OP_PUSHBYTES_20 b666aa3060f14b13f585f0d08a57fe7a55fecd16
address
tb1qken25vrq79938av97rgg54l70f2langkvy7689
transaction
d327937f0a8a04bf914da3c11cb2a3b4896cff788421609c1d3bf47eaa1f45ae
confirmations
183031
spent
true